Description - Keys delighted to welcome to the market this deceptively spacious elevated Detached Bungalow occupying a generous plot in the popular and convenient location of Light Oaks, handily placed for Festival Retail Park, Hanley shopping centre and good commuter links via the A500/A50. With loads of garden space to front, side and rear and a home that is oozing with loads of potential for modernisation and the possibility for extending it is, the perfect project for a family upsizing and looking for their dream home. The generous well planned accommodation comprises; lounge, dining room, breakfast kitchen, conservatory, two bedrooms, family bathroom and a cloakroom. There is a drive providing off road parking and leading to an integral double garage. This is an opportunity not to be missed and viewing are highly recommended.
Lounge - 6.2m x 5.3m (20'4" x 17'4") - Spacious lounge with coving to the ceiling, radiator, ceiling and wall light points, uPVC double glazed window with front aspect, uPVC french doors to outside, archway leads through to dining room
Dining Room - 3.1m x 3m (10'2" x 9'10") - Coving to the ceiling, radiator, ceiling light point, uPVC double glazed window
Breakfast Kitchen - 5.4m x 3.1m (17'8" x 10'2") - Fitted with arange of wall and base units with co-ordinating worktops, built in eye level double oven, halogen hob and extractor, sink and drainer with mixer tap, plumbing for washing machine, spaces for appliances. Ceiling light point, radiator, part wall tiled, uPVC double glazed window, uPVC sliding doors leading into the conservatory.
Conservatory - 4.6m x 2.9m (15'1" x 9'6") - Ceramic tiled flooring, electric sockets, doors to rear garden area
Cloaks - 1.9m x 1m (6'2" x 3'3") - Fitted with a two piece cloakroom suite comprises low level wc and wall mounted wash hand basin. Ceiling light point, laminated flooring
Bedroom One - 5.5m x 4m (18'0" x 13'1") - Ceiling light point, radiator, uPVC double glazed window, uPVC door leading into the conservatory
Bedroom Two - 4m x 3.7m (13'1" x 12'1") - Ceiling light point, radiator, uPVC double glazed window.
Bathroom - 3m x 2.7m (9'10" x 8'10") - Fitted with a four piece white suite comprises panelled bath, separate shower enclosure, pedestal wash hand basin, low level w.c. Ceiling light point, radiator, fully wall tiled, uPVC double glazed window
Outside - Mature gardens around the property which is currently overgrown. Drive providing ample off road parking, large double garage
